WebJul 19, 2016 · The most common cause of this type of problem is when the fuel filler neck’s inner tube comes off of the neck itself. You will need to have the filler neck removed to check to see if the inner tube was knocked off from someone trying to get fuel out of tank with a siphon hose and managed to knock the hose off. WebJun 2, 2024 · Since gas spilled out, I would assume that it happened before and most likely gas got into your EVAP canister which may now be saturated. A saturated EVAP canister cannot vent properly as well which may be leading up to your symptoms. If you get under the truck on the driver's side, you can see your EVAP system.

If you smell gas after filling up the vehicle at the gas station and the smell doesn’t go away, you might have spilled gas on the exterior of your car. This is nothing to be concerned about, as you may have accidentally splashed gas on your vehicle. Locating the spill and cleaning it up should solve the issue. Age cyber security 8200WebNov 19, 2008 · It is simply a drain hole with a tube that routes overflow or splash spillage down to the ground. You certainly do not want overflow gasoline just sitting there in the recess behind the cover, so the drain is there to allow it to flow to the ground.
